Role Overview The Advisory Trading Analyst serves as a strategic partner to financial representatives and clients, combining advanced trading knowledge with analytical insight to deliver exceptional service and optimize investment outcomes. This role focuses on trade execution, portfolio alignment, and advisory support within a dynamic, fast-paced environment. Key Responsibilities Client Advisory & Relationship Management Provide consultative guidance on trading strategies and investment solutions tailored to client objectives. Act as a trusted resource for financial representatives, fostering strong relationships and promoting client retention. Trade Execution & Analysis Execute trades across multiple asset classes—equities, ETFs, mutual funds, and fixed income—with precision and efficiency. Analyze trade activity and market trends to ensure alignment with client goals and regulatory standards. Portfolio Support & Optimization Assist in portfolio construction and rebalancing, leveraging deep product knowledge and market insights. Identify opportunities to enhance portfolio performance and mitigate risk. Operational Oversight & Compliance Monitor daily trading activity, ensuring timely processing and adherence to industry regulations and internal policies. Maintain rigorous standards for confidentiality, data security, and compliance. Issue Resolution & Risk Management Collaborate across teams and external partners to resolve trade discrepancies, margin calls, and error corrections. Proactively identify and address potential risks impacting trade execution or client portfolios. Technology & Process Innovation Utilize advanced trading platforms and analytical tools to streamline workflows and improve accuracy. Champion digital solutions and self-service capabilities to enhance client experience and operational efficiency.
